ip查询网站源码-查询IP地址小脚本(对接API)

白天看新闻的时候ip查询网站源码,无意中听到了关于网店IP查询API的信息,然后就写了一个IP地址查询的脚本来分享一下。 先贴出天猫IP查询API的使用方法供读者研究:

1. 请求套接字(GET):

/service/getIpInfo.php?ip=[ip 地址字符串]

2、响应信息:

ip查询网站源码_源码查询网站_网站ip查询

(json格式)国家、省(自治区、直辖市)、市(县)、运营商

3、返回数据格式:

{"code":0,"data":{"ip":"210.75.225.254","国家":"u4e2du56fd","地区":"u534eu5317",

"地区":"u5317u4eacu5e02","城市":"u5317u4eacu5e02","县":"","isp":"u7535u4fe1",

"country_id":"86","area_id":"100000","re​​gion_id":"110000","city_id":"110000",

“county_id”:“-1”ip查询网站源码,“isp_id”:“100017”}}

源码查询网站_ip查询网站源码_网站ip查询

code的值的含义是,0:成功,1:失败。

这里返回的数据是json的形式,目前公共API中返回的数据大致分为两种格式:XML和json。

贴出脚本源码:

源码查询网站_网站ip查询_ip查询网站源码

#!/usr/local/bin/python

#编码=utf-8

#作者:c0ld

网站ip查询_源码查询网站_ip查询网站源码

导入urllib

导入urllib2

导入 json

ip=raw_input('请输入IP地址:')